PUEBLO, Colo. – At this coming Sunday's Total Program Meeting in the Occhiato Student Center Ballroom, which will open the 2025-26 school year for CSU Pueblo student-athletes, the Tundra Spirit of the Pack Award will be awarded to one female and one male student-athlete.
The Tundra Spirit of the Pack Award, which was first awarded in 2020, is given to the student-athlete who most exemplifies the heart of the ThunderWolf spirit. Through selfless loyalty, dedication, and support of their teammates, the student encourages and inspires their teammates to be at their best not only on the field but as active members of the community. This student's enthusiasm and devotion to their Pack Family and CSU Pueblo embody the true spirit of the Pack.
Each winner of the award (male and female student-athlete) will receive a $1,000 scholarship (on top of their current award), and the award is given on behalf of Carol and Mark Rickman.
"Thanks to Carol and Mark Rickman, the Tundra Spirit of the Pack Award has gained tremendous momentum among our sport programs. Our coaches and student-athletes take great pride in this annual scholarship award because it celebrates character, leadership and the true spirit of Pack Athletics. It has become a meaningful tradition that not only recognizes excellence, but also inspires our teams to embody the values that make CSU Pueblo special," said CSU Pueblo Vice President of Athletics and Strategic Partnerships
Dr. Paul Plinske.
This year's list of nominees features eight male student-athletes from eight different sports, while there are 10 female student-athletes nominated from 10 different sports.
Their head coaches nominate the student-athletes, and those nominees are selected for the award by an "esteemed" panel in the athletics department.
